The Seven Fundamentals of Marketing Success
-
Identify the Most Profitable Prospects
One of the primary steps in any successful marketing strategy is identifying the most profitable prospects. Businesses often operate with limited budgets and manpower, making it crucial to focus on segments that promise the highest return on investment (ROI). By analyzing key performance indicators (KPIs) such as volume, frequency, recency, and profitability, marketers can hone in on their ideal customers rather than spreading themselves too thin. -
Identify the Most Efficient Marketing Channels
Understanding where to allocate time and resources is essential. After segmenting the customer base, businesses can develop profiles based on shared attributes. Identifying trends within the most promising segments allows for targeted marketing efforts. It is important to recognize the customer journey, from awareness to decision-making, and to engage them at critical moments to influence their purchasing decisions effectively. -
Stand Out from the Competition
In a crowded marketplace, differentiation is key. Conducting a competitive analysis can illuminate what makes your brand unique compared to others. This involves not only defining your brand’s core identity but also understanding public perception and value propositions. A strong unique selling proposition (USP) will clearly communicate to potential customers why they should choose your product over the competition. -
Attract & Convert “Ready-to-Buy” Prospects
Creating an engagement calendar can help maintain a consistent presence in your audience's mind, ensuring that your brand remains top-of-mind when prospects are ready to make a purchase. Regularly scheduled interactions can nurture relationships and transform interest into sales. -
Accelerate the Sales Cycle
By continuously providing valuable engagement material, businesses can streamline the sales process. This allows sales teams to focus on closing deals rather than spending excessive time nurturing leads. Additionally, incorporating urgency into messaging can encourage prospects to act swiftly. -
Increase Sales
A successful marketing plan always begins with the end in mind. Understanding the conversion process is essential. By mapping out the customer journey and anticipating their needs, businesses can create strategies that drive sales effectively. -
Increase Sales & Marketing ROI
Continuous evaluation of marketing strategies is critical. Identifying both strengths and weaknesses allows businesses to adapt and improve their approach. This iterative process ensures that marketing efforts remain aligned with organizational goals and market demands.
Understanding Core Beliefs
While marketing success hinges on external factors, internal beliefs play a significant role in shaping one’s approach to both business and personal life. Core beliefs are strong, often inflexible convictions that govern one's worldview and self-perception. These beliefs can be helpful or detrimental, influencing how individuals interact with their environment and perceive success.
Core beliefs often develop from early experiences and can be reinforced by societal messages. For example, a belief that “the world is a dangerous place” can lead to increased anxiety and a reluctance to engage with new opportunities. Conversely, believing in one’s competence can foster resilience and a proactive approach to challenges.
How to Identify Core Beliefs
-
Noticing Thoughts
Pay attention to automatic thoughts that arise in daily situations. By becoming aware of recurring patterns, individuals can start to uncover underlying beliefs. -
Keeping a Diary
Recording thoughts and feelings over time can provide insights, particularly during moments of strong emotion or stress. This practice can reveal consistent themes. -
Considering Evidence
When faced with beliefs that seem unchangeable despite contradicting evidence, it’s likely that these are core beliefs. Challenging these thoughts can lead to personal growth and a shift in perspective.
